Title: Innovations of Arnold M. Levine: A Spotlight on His Contributions
Introduction
Arnold M. Levine, based in Chatsworth, California, is a remarkable inventor known for his innovative contributions to radar systems and audio technologies. With a portfolio of 14 patents, Levine has made significant strides in enhancing the functionality and efficiency of electronic systems, particularly in the fields of radar and film audio technology.
Latest Patents
Levine's latest patents include the creation of a radar system with auxiliary scanning capabilities. This advanced radar system is designed to provide extended dwell time on targets, incorporating both electronic and mechanical scanning methods. The electronic embodiment features a phased-array auxiliary antenna with diode phase shifters, while the mechanical embodiment utilizes a rotating multi-sided prism to enhance data collection.
Another notable patent is his electro-optical motion picture film sound track recording and playback system. This innovative system employs pulse-code modulation techniques to sample and digitally encode complex audio signals, applying the digital codes to the film sound track. The system also includes scrambling techniques that significantly hinder unauthorized copying, ensuring the integrity of the audio experience.
